| /arch/riscv/include/asm/ |
| A D | cpufeature-macros.h | 15 #define riscv_isa_extension_available(isa_bitmap, ext) \ argument 19 const unsigned long ext) in __riscv_has_extension_likely() 33 const unsigned long ext) in __riscv_has_extension_unlikely() 46 static __always_inline bool riscv_has_extension_unlikely(const unsigned long ext) in riscv_has_extension_unlikely() 56 static __always_inline bool riscv_has_extension_likely(const unsigned long ext) in riscv_has_extension_likely()
|
| A D | vendor_extensions.h | 45 #define riscv_cpu_isa_vendor_extension_available(cpu, vendor, ext) \ argument 47 #define riscv_isa_vendor_extension_available(vendor, ext) \ argument 52 const unsigned long ext) in riscv_has_vendor_extension_likely() 65 const unsigned long ext) in riscv_has_vendor_extension_unlikely() 78 int cpu, const unsigned long ext) in riscv_cpu_has_vendor_extension_likely() 92 const unsigned long ext) in riscv_cpu_has_vendor_extension_unlikely()
|
| A D | cpufeature.h | 131 static __always_inline bool riscv_cpu_has_extension_likely(int cpu, const unsigned long ext) in riscv_cpu_has_extension_likely() 142 static __always_inline bool riscv_cpu_has_extension_unlikely(int cpu, const unsigned long ext) in riscv_cpu_has_extension_unlikely()
|
| /arch/mips/boot/dts/xilfpga/ |
| A D | microAptiv.dtsi | 18 ext: ext { label
|
| /arch/riscv/include/asm/vendor_extensions/ |
| A D | vendor_hwprobe.h | 11 #define VENDOR_EXT_KEY(ext) \ argument
|
| /arch/riscv/kernel/ |
| A D | cpufeature.c | 547 static void riscv_isa_set_ext(const struct riscv_isa_ext_data *ext, unsigned long *bitmap) in riscv_isa_set_ext() 580 const struct riscv_isa_ext_data *ext; in riscv_resolve_isa() local 621 const struct riscv_isa_ext_data *ext = &riscv_isa_ext[i]; in match_isa_ext() local 642 const char *ext = isa++; in riscv_parse_isa_string() local 885 const struct riscv_isa_ext_data ext = ext_list->ext_data[j]; in riscv_fill_cpu_vendor_ext() local 994 const struct riscv_isa_ext_data *ext = &riscv_isa_ext[i]; in riscv_fill_hwcap_from_ext_list() local
|
| A D | sbi_ecall.c | 23 int fid, int ext) in __sbi_ecall()
|
| A D | sys_hwprobe.c | 86 #define EXT_KEY(ext) \ in hwprobe_isa_ext0() argument 174 static bool hwprobe_ext0_has(const struct cpumask *cpus, u64 ext) in hwprobe_ext0_has()
|
| A D | sbi.c | 210 int ext = SBI_EXT_RFENCE; in __sbi_rfence_v02_call() local
|
| /arch/riscv/kvm/ |
| A D | vcpu_sbi.c | 431 const struct kvm_vcpu_sbi_extension *ext; in kvm_vcpu_sbi_find_ext() local 520 const struct kvm_vcpu_sbi_extension *ext; in kvm_riscv_vcpu_sbi_init() local 549 const struct kvm_vcpu_sbi_extension *ext; in kvm_riscv_vcpu_sbi_deinit() local 572 const struct kvm_vcpu_sbi_extension *ext; in kvm_riscv_vcpu_sbi_reset() local
|
| A D | vm.c | 174 int kvm_vm_ioctl_check_extension(struct kvm *kvm, long ext) in kvm_vm_ioctl_check_extension()
|
| A D | vcpu_onereg.c | 23 #define KVM_ISA_EXT_ARR(ext) \ argument 145 static bool kvm_riscv_vcpu_isa_enable_allowed(unsigned long ext) in kvm_riscv_vcpu_isa_enable_allowed() 168 static bool kvm_riscv_vcpu_isa_disable_allowed(unsigned long ext) in kvm_riscv_vcpu_isa_disable_allowed()
|
| /arch/mips/boot/dts/ingenic/ |
| A D | jz4740.dtsi | 42 ext: ext { label
|
| A D | jz4725b.dtsi | 42 ext: ext { label
|
| A D | jz4770.dtsi | 42 ext: ext { label
|
| A D | jz4780.dtsi | 52 ext: ext { label
|
| /arch/mips/include/uapi/asm/ |
| A D | ucontext.h | 36 struct extcontext ext; member
|
| /arch/loongarch/kvm/ |
| A D | vm.c | 80 int kvm_vm_ioctl_check_extension(struct kvm *kvm, long ext) in kvm_vm_ioctl_check_extension()
|
| /arch/x86/events/ |
| A D | utils.c | 10 int ext; in decode_branch_type() local
|
| /arch/x86/kvm/vmx/ |
| A D | vmx_ops.h | 306 static inline void __invvpid(unsigned long ext, u16 vpid, gva_t gva) in __invvpid() 317 static inline void __invept(unsigned long ext, u64 eptp) in __invept()
|
| /arch/arm64/include/asm/ |
| A D | kvm_pkvm.h | 28 static inline bool kvm_pvm_ext_allowed(long ext) in kvm_pvm_ext_allowed()
|
| /arch/arm/include/asm/ |
| A D | pgtable-2level.h | 237 #define set_pte_ext(ptep,pte,ext) cpu_set_pte_ext(ptep,pte,ext) argument
|
| A D | pgtable-3level.h | 171 #define set_pte_ext(ptep,pte,ext) cpu_set_pte_ext(ptep,__pte(pte_val(pte)|(ext))) argument
|
| /arch/s390/kernel/ |
| A D | sysinfo.c | 140 struct sysinfo_1_2_2_extension *ext; in stsi_1_2_2() local
|
| /arch/powerpc/kvm/ |
| A D | book3s_hv_builtin.c | 572 int ext; in kvmppc_guest_entry_inject_int() local
|